LABOR RELATIONS SPECIALIST/SENIOR ANALYST, Vice President for Human Resources , to support administration of collective bargaining agreements and management of our unionized workforce. This role combines analytical expertise with hands-on employee relations responsibilities, requiring strong problem-solving skills and knowledge of labor relations and contract interpretation; advise managers on contract compliance, union personnel supervision, and labor-related issues; conduct grievance hearings, workplace investigations, and conflict resolution; draft decisions and labor relations documentation; prepare statistical analyses and costing models for negotiations and arbitrations; maintain wage data, benefits utilization, union membership records, and grievance statistics; participate in labor-management meetings, negotiations, and arbitrations; develop and deliver training programs on contract compliance and union environment management; and support strategic HR projects and process improvement initiatives.
Job Requirements
REQUIRED :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Labor Relations, or related discipline; a minimum of five years of experience in labor relations, HR analytics, or advising in a unionized environment; demonstrated proficiency with HRIS systems, Excel, SAP, FileMaker, and reporting tools; excellent verbal and written communication skills; demonstrated ability to interact constructively with employees at all levels and union representatives; and strong organizational and record-management skills. PREFERRED : Bilingual fluency (English/Spanish); SHRM-CP or related HR certification; experience conducting workplace investigations; ability to obtain government clearance and availability for intermittent second or third shift coverage.
